Thanks for your comments about the thimbles. I now have one that I am using, and I have to say that it is lovely to work with - much nicer than a metal ring thimble, you don't get sweaty or rust rings on the fingers :wink: . I learnt to use ring thimbles from tailoring and place it on the end of the middle finger, as opposed to the japanese who place it between the 1st & 2nd joints of the middle finger.
This is where I first found out the details of making them http://mamercerie.blogspot.co.uk/
further details can be found here http://www.temarikai.com/yubinuki/yu...general01.html and a bit more here http://washi-and-silk.de/blog/2011/06/samstag-in-pink/ you will need to hit the translate button for this last one unless you can read german.
Finally http://home-and-garden.webshots.com/...49837847AxgQba
http://home-and-garden.webshots.com/...49837847scAdsR
http://home-and-garden.webshots.com/...49837847MQUMPm will give you a 3 part video of how to make them, Personally, so far I make my thimbles 1/2" deep and prefer to use a strip of paper about 16" long rather than 2 turns of card, which I have tried but don't like as much for the finished article. I am also part way through making a bangle, so it doesn't have to be tiny.
